UNC sophomore outfielder Brandon Riley was named the ACC Baseball Player of the Week on Monday, the first time he’s earned the honor during his young career.

The Burlington native put together nine hits across 16 at-bats in the Tar Heels’ four games last week–a win over East Carolina on Wednesday and a series victory over Miami over the weekend.

This included a pair of home runs, eight RBIs and five runs scored himself.

Riley currently leads the Tar Heels with 21 RBIs–including a team-high 10 RBIs against conference competition–which has helped UNC (18-6, 6-3 ACC) climb to the top of the ACC Coastal Division.

He also ranks third on the team with a .313 batting average for the season, one of four players hitting above .300 for head coach Mike Fox.
